fix(drtm): remove plat_system_reset()
The name plat_system_reset() has been in use for some time by a mediatek platform (in plat/mediatek/mt8173/plat_pm.c). However, DRTM added a global hook, that is only implemented on FVP, that conflicts with it. This sometimes results in failed builds.
DRTM remediation ends with a platform reset. However, there is currently an error message printed that this is not supported. In this case, the correct thing to do is to panic and as such this hook is not needed.
Further, the correct sequence to reset the system is different and is only fully implemented by psci_system_reset(). This is a portable implementation supported by a wide variety of platform.
So remove plat_system_reset(). Once DRTM remediation properly supports resetting, the psci_system_reset() function should be used to achieve reset correctly and portably.

refactor(plat/arm): update NV flags on image load/authentication failure
Erasing the FIP TOC header present in a flash is replaced by updating NV flags with an error code on image load/authentication failure. BL1 component uses these NV flags to detect whether a firmware update is needed or not. These NV flags get cleared once the firmware update gets completed.

arm: Shorten the Firmware Update (FWU) process
The watchdog is configured with a default value of 256 seconds in order to implement the Trusted Board Boot Requirements.
For the FVP and Juno platforms, the FWU process relies on a watchdog reset. In order to automate the test of FWU, the length of this process needs to be as short as possible. Instead of waiting for those 4 minutes to have a reset by the watchdog, tell it to reset immediately.
There are no side effects as the value of the watchdog's load register resets to 0xFFFFFFFF.
Tested on Juno.

Add WFI in platform's unexpected error handlers
This patch adds a WFI instruction in the default implementations of plat_error_handler() and plat_panic_handler(). This potentially reduces power consumption by allowing the hardware to enter a low-power state. The same change has been made to the FVP and Juno platform ports.

TBB: add Trusted Watchdog support on ARM platforms
This patch adds watchdog support on ARM platforms (FVP and Juno). A secure instance of SP805 is used as Trusted Watchdog. It is entirely managed in BL1, being enabled in the early platform setup hook and disabled in the exit hook. By default, the watchdog is enabled in every build (even when TBB is disabled).
A new ARM platform specific build option `ARM_DISABLE_TRUSTED_WDOG` has been introduced to allow the user to disable the watchdog at build time. This feature may be used for testing or debugging purposes.
Specific error handlers for Juno and FVP are also provided in this patch. These handlers will be called after an image load or authentication error. On FVP, the Table of Contents (ToC) in the FIP is erased. On Juno, the corresponding error code is stored in the V2M Non-Volatile flags register. In both cases, the CPU spins until a watchdog reset is generated after 256 seconds (as specified in the TBBR document).
